Professor Marston and the Wonder Women

Theatrical Release Date: 10/13/2017
Overall Rating: 2.9 out of 4 stars
Language: English
Genre: Biography
MPAA Rating: R
Director: Angela Robinson
Actors: Luke Evans, Rebecca Hall, JJ Feild, Connie Britton
Plot: Dr. William Marston was a Harvard professor, psychologist and inventor - and also the creator of Wonder Woman. He was inspired by both his wife, Elizabeth - also an psychologist and inventor, along with Olive Byrne, a former student. All three formed a polyamorous relationship which helped shape Wonder Woman, and the controversy surrounding the character.

Human Flow

Theatrical Release Date: 10/13/2017
Overall Rating: 3.0 out of 4 stars
Language: English
Genre: Documentary
MPAA Rating: PG-13
Director: Ai Weiwei
Actors: Peter Bouckaert, Wella Kouyou, Samah Nabeel, Muhammed Hassan
Plot: Director and artist Ai Weiwei presents a story that has affected 65 million people around the world: whether through famine, climate change or war, the human race has never experienced this much displacement since WWII. Following families across the globe over the course of a year, from Afghanistan to Greece, Iraq to Mexico - 23 countries in all, Ai Weiwei explores the affect this has on people and families in a refugee crisis that has exploded and the very real impact it has worldwide.
